Output c4e5389ccd0f77cbec6bd85de896d5a4faa4b7917080b7894a8de923b66478f9:22

value
18643175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243b38a5398d7360e61a81b1966208edd380b8aa OP_EQUAL
address
34zbCDTt3tB5c3XHZd3Ne6GQPXHTwV1KU4
transaction
c4e5389ccd0f77cbec6bd85de896d5a4faa4b7917080b7894a8de923b66478f9
spent
true